Joseph Bommersbach aka Blind Joe started singing when he was a 3-year-old little boy on a farm in North Dakota. He started playing the guitar when he was five. His grandfather, an accordion player, was his mentor and inspiration. And now Blind Joe is on Team Shelton on The Voice! He said his blind audition was nerve-wracking. “I’m not built for competition at all,” Blind Joe told local radio station KQDJ’s Warren Abrahamson.

Rumors abound in Fargo about the country-turned-pop diva Taylor Swift and Blind Joe performing together. Swift is scheduled to perform at the Fargodome on October 12 and she’s known to invite local celebrities on stage. Abrahamson asked Blind Joe about the rumors. “I haven’t heard anything from Taylor’s Swift camp,” he said. “But, man, that would be cool.” Blind Joe will square-off with Blaine Mitchell during the first battle round (Oct 11).
